Cost of Living in Strumica - Updated Prices & Insights

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ends around $882 per month with rent, or $522 for everyday expenses alone.

A couple spends around $1,258 per month with rent, or $834 for everyday expenses alone.

A family of three spends around $1,634 per month with rent, or $1,146 without housing.

Overall, Strumica is 34–42% below the global median across household types. Within Europe, costs are well below average (50% lower) – one of the most affordable options in the region.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the city center costs around $321, dropping to $242 outside central areas. Housing accounts for roughly 49% of the average salary ($649) – well above the 30% international benchmark.

The average net salary is $649 – below monthly costs of $882. Most locals rely on shared housing or dual incomes. Remote workers earning abroad will find stronger purchasing power.

Groceries cost around $186 per month for one person. A mid-range dinner for two is priced at $28.00 – well below the European average of $75.0.

A monthly public transport pass costs about $20.41 – among the cheapest in Europe (average $48.00).
